Job Description
The Reliability Engineering team helps realize our vision by supporting Coinbase engineering teams to build software that is world-class in terms of its reliability. As a core service team, Coinbase Reliability Engineers work closely with the rest of engineering. We proactively seek out and gather the state-of-the-art, best practices from the industry at large. Through education and advocacy, we seek to ensure that reliability is a core value of our engineering culture. We level up other engineers by sharing deep knowledge, performing proactive analysis and improving processes, tools, and automation. Ultimately, Reliability Engineering succeeds when all engineering teams are able to build reliable software on their own. The role involves improving observability, reliability and availability by defining and measuring key metrics. Building automation and improving systems to eliminate toil and operations work. Collaborating with core infrastructure team to performance tune and optimize cloud deployments. Working with product teams to reduce service disruptions and automate incident response. Finding and analyzing reliability problems across business units and stack, then design and implement software to create step-function improvements. Educating, mentoring and holding accountable the engineering team to improve the reliability of our systems and make reliability a core value of the Coinbase engineering culture. Writing high quality, well tested code to meet the needs of your customers.
About Coinbase
At Coinbase, their mission is to increase economic freedom in the world.